Core Web VitalsSEO

SEO’da Core Web Vitals Optimizasyonu İçin İleri Seviye Öneriler

Core Web Vitals (CWV), Google’ın kullanıcı deneyimini ölçmek için geliştirdiği en önemli metriklerdir. Largest Contentful Paint (LCP), First Input Delay (FID, artık INP oldu) ve Cumulative Layout Shift (CLS) gibi metrikler üzerinden performans değerlendirmesi yapılır.

SEO'da Core Web Vitals Optimizasyonu
SEO’da Core Web Vitals Optimizasyonu İçin İleri Seviye Öneriler

Bu metrikler için ileri düzey optimizasyon teknikleri:

1. Largest Contentful Paint (LCP) Optimizasyonu

LCP, bir web sayfasının en büyük görsel ya da metin bloğunun yüklenme süresini ölçer. İdeal süre: 2,5 saniye veya daha az.

İleri Seviye Teknikler:

  1. Kritik CSS’leri Ayrıştırma ve Ön Yükleme
    • Critical CSS aracını kullanarak kritik stilleri belirleyin.
    • Geri kalan CSS’leri asenkron yükleyin.
    • rel="preload" etiketiyle CSS dosyalarını önceden yükleyin.
  2. Resimlerin Optimizasyonu
    • WebP veya AVIF formatlarını kullanarak resim boyutlarını küçültün.
    • Lazy Loading yerine, Priority Loading uygulayarak görünür alandaki (viewport) resimleri önceliklendirin.
  3. Sunucu Yanıt Süresini (TTFB) İyileştirme
    • CDN (Content Delivery Network) kullanarak içeriği kullanıcıya en yakın lokasyondan sunun.
    • Sunucuyu daha performanslı hale getirmek için HTTP/2 veya HTTP/3 protokollerine geçiş yapın.
  4. Render Engelleyen Kaynakları Ortadan Kaldırma
    • Google PageSpeed Insights raporlarını kullanarak render engelleyen kaynakları tespit edin.
    • Bu kaynakları mümkün olduğunca asenkron hale getirin.

2. First Input Delay (FID) Optimizasyonu

FID, kullanıcının bir işlem başlatma girişimine kadar geçen süredir. İdeal süre: 100 ms veya daha az.

İleri Seviye Teknikler:

  1. JavaScript Çalışmalarını İyileştirme
    • Kullanılmayan JavaScript’i temizlemek için Tree Shaking ve Code Splitting uygulayın.
    • Lightweight Frameworks (örneğin, Preact veya Svelte) kullanarak daha az JavaScript kodu üretin.
  2. Web Worker’ları Kullanın
    • Zaman alıcı işlemleri (ör. ağır hesaplamalar) Web Worker ile arka planda çalıştırarak ana thread’i serbest bırakın.
  3. Event Listener Yönetimi
    • Çok fazla event listener eklemek yerine Event Delegation stratejisini benimseyin.
    • Kritik olmayan event listener’ları yükleme sırasında erteleyin.
  4. Third-Party Script’leri Azaltın
    • Google Tag Manager veya benzeri araçlar üzerinden üçüncü parti script’leri asenkron hale getirin.
    • Kullanılmayan veya eski script’leri kaldırarak yükleme süresini azaltın.

Not: FID, 12 Mart 2024’te Interaction to Next Paint (INP) ile Core Web Vitals olarak değiştirildi.

3. Cumulative Layout Shift (CLS) Optimizasyonu

CLS, sayfa yüklenirken öğelerin kaymasıyla oluşan görsel istikrarsızlığı ölçer. İdeal değer: 0,1 veya daha az.

İleri Seviye Teknikler:

  1. Boyut Tanımlama
    • Tüm medya öğelerine (resim, video, iframe) sabit bir genişlik ve yükseklik değeri tanımlayın.
    • Dinamik içerik yüklenirken yer tutucular (placeholder) kullanın.
  2. Font Optimizasyonu
    • Font-Display: Swap özelliğini kullanarak yazı tipi yüklenene kadar bir yedek font gösterin.
    • Harici font yüklemesini hızlandırmak için rel="preload" etiketi ekleyin.
  3. Animasyonlarda Performans İyileştirme
    • CSS transformasyonları ve animasyonlarını GPU Accelerated (GPU Destekli) hale getirin.
    • Layout değişiklikleri yerine opacity ve transform gibi özelliklerle animasyon oluşturun.
  4. Reklam ve Embed Yüklemeleri
    • Dinamik reklam alanları için sabit bir yükseklik belirleyin.
    • Reklam yüklemelerini geciktirirken sayfa düzenini bozmayacak bir çerçeve oluşturun.

4. Global Optimizasyon Teknikleri

Bu teknikler tüm Core Web Vitals metriklerine olumlu katkı sağlar.

  1. HTTP/3 ve QUIC Protokolü Kullanımı
    • Daha hızlı ve güvenli veri iletimi sağlar.
    • Yükleme süresini önemli ölçüde azaltır.
  2. Edge Computing ve Serverless Architecture
    • Statik içeriklerin hızla teslim edilmesi için edge sunucularını kullanın.
    • Dinamik içerik işleme için Serverless Functions entegre edin.
  3. Browser Caching ve Pre-fetching
    • Statik kaynakları kullanıcı tarayıcısında önbelleğe alarak sayfa yükleme hızını artırın.
    • Kullanıcının muhtemel tıklama yapacağı linkleri önceden yüklemek için prefetch özelliğini kullanın.
  4. Performans İzleme ve Test
    • Lighthouse, WebPageTest ve Chrome DevTools kullanarak düzenli performans testleri yapın.
    • Verileri sürekli izlemek için Google Search Console Core Web Vitals raporlarını takip edin.

Ek İpuçları

  • AMP (Accelerated Mobile Pages): Mobil cihazlar için daha hızlı yükleme süreleri sağlar.
  • Service Worker: Kullanıcıların çevrimdışı veya yavaş internet bağlantısında daha iyi bir deneyim yaşamasını sağlar.
  • A/B Testleri: Yaptığınız optimizasyonların etkisini görmek için farklı sürümler arasında test yapın.

Bu teknikler, Core Web Vitals metriklerini optimize etmek ve Google sıralamalarınızı iyileştirmek için ileri seviye bir yol haritası sunar. Her bir metriği detaylıca ele alıp uyguladığınızda, SEO performansınızda gözle görülür bir artış elde edebilirsiniz.

Alparslan DUYGU

Alparslan DUYGU, 6 yılı aşkın deneyime sahip bir SEO ve Google ADS uzmanıdır. Dijital pazarlama alanında edindiği bilgi birikimi ve uygulamalı tecrübeleri sayesinde, işletmelerin çevrimiçi görünürlüklerini artırarak daha geniş kitlelere ulaşmalarını sağlamaktadır.

Bir yanıt yazın

E-posta adresiniz yayınl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ir

Başa dön tuşu